Nordic Skiing Ends Season At NCAA Central Region Championships

The Gustavus men’s and women’s nordic skiing teams ended their 2011-12 campaigns at the NCAA Central Region Skiing Championships on Feb. 17-18 in Ishpeming, Mich. The women’s squad took fifth with 112 points and the men placed sixth with 99 points.

Nordic Skiers Take Sixth At CCSA Championships

Both the Gustavus men’s and women’s nordic skiing teams placed sixth at the Central Collegiate Ski Association (CCSA) Championships held in Houghton, Mich. on Saturday and Sunday. The men’s team collected 127 points, while the women tallied 140.

Gabe Hanson led the Gustie men on Saturday with a 37th place finish in the 10K Classic. 

Nordic Skiers Show Improvement At Battle Creek Super Tour

The Gustavus men’s and women’s nordic skiing teams competed in the Battle Creek Super Tour on Saturday and Sunday in Lake Elmo, Minn. The men came away with a third place finish with 84 combined points, while the women took fourth with 66 points.

Marian Lund led the Gustie women with 41st place finishes both days. 

Men’s And Women’s Nordic Skiing Place Sixth At Mayor’s Challenge

The Gustavus men’s and women’s nordic skiing teams each placed sixth at the Mayor’s Challenge in Minneapolis Saturday and Sunday. Marian Lund and Anders Bowman led their respective teams for the Gusties. Lund took 41st in both Saturday’s 5K Classic and Sunday’s 10K Freestyle with a time of 19:39.4 and 26:20.0, respectively. Bowman took 38th place in Saturday’s 10K Classic with a time of 24:46.1 and placed 36th in Sunday’s 15K Freestyle in 36:49.8.

Men’s And Women’s Nordic Skiing Take Fifth At Saints Hilltop Invitational

Both the Gustavus men’s and women’s nordic skiing teams took fifth place at the Saints Hilltop Invitational hosted by the College of St. Scholastica on Saturday and Sunday in Coleraine, Minn. Each team combined for a total of 70 points – the men earned 34 points in Saturday’s 10K Freestyle and 36 in Sunday’s Classic, while the women garnered 31 points in the 5K Freestyle and 39 in the Classic.
